#fb9906 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fb9906 is composed of 98.4% red, 60%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39% magenta, 97.6%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 36 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 50.4%. #fb9906 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0c with #f73300. Closest websafe color is: #ff9900.

Shades and Tints of #fb9906

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fff8ee is the lightest one.
